WandaVision

Instagram

Just like their movies, Marvel Studios’ web series revolves around their superheroes and TBH, it’s a treat to watch them. WandaVision is about a newlywed couple, Wanda and Vision, who have moved to a friendly neighbourhood of Westview. Wait, where is Westview? Never heard of it. That’s because it doesn’t exist. But only, it does. In different years, on different frequencies, and in different worlds.

Actors Paul Bettany and Elizabeth Olsen are nominated for the Outstanding Lead Actor and Actress in a Limited Series or Movie. And gotta say, we’re rooting for them to win!

The Crown

Instagram

The show revolves around the life of Queen Elizabeth II. And, it will leave you surprised with all the revelations it has made about the British royal family. It has been nominated for the Outstanding Drama Series.

Pose

Instagram

Pose will take you back to the 80s and 90s and leave you super emo. It revolves around the ball culture of that era as well as the gay and trans community. It is nominated for the Outstanding Drama Series category, and now you know why we said that the competition is cutthroat!

Mare Of Easttown

Instagram

It’s always a pleasure to watch Kate Winslet perform on-screen. And, she doesn’t disappoint us in Mare of Easttown where she plays the role of a detective, investigating a gruesome murder. This nail-biting drama will keep you on the edge and has been rightly nominated for the Outstanding Limited Series category.
